Lots of things not working on my 87

First off, this is my first maxima in a few years.. I've owned many 3rd and 4th gens, mostly black on black se manual models, which have become hens teeth in any generation, and this is the first 2nd Gen I've actually owned (not counting the 2 tone taupe 86 an ex girlfriend owned that actually kind of got me into maximas in the first place over 20 years ago) . Picked it up extremely cheap from a dealer who wanted it out of his back lot but had to tow it home.

I've got it up and running and other than a hole in the muffler somewhere it runs and drives smooth and quick and doesn't appear to be too poorly maintained. However there is an electrical gremlin or 2.. The AC, blower motor, wipers, and radio do not turn on, plus there is a clicking sound coming from the dash and a Sensor light on.

I don't know if it's all related but if anyone has a clue where to start I'd really appreciate it.

This fix is probably just the ACC fuse being blown. All that you mention runs off the ACC circuit. If the new fuse burns out again then more work tracing what's causing the problem. You probably should get a Nissan Service Manual off of eBay which are going for cheap ($10) now that we don't see hardly any 2nd Gen Maxima on the road. Good Luck

The sensor light is something that needs to be unplugged, it was a service thing for the first few thousand miles, double check and make sure the long term storage switch is on, it's next to the fuse box
